About Radarr

Radarr is a PVR for Usenet and BitTorrent users. It can monitor multiple RSS feeds for new episodes of your favorite shows and will grab, sort and rename them. It can also be configured to automatically upgrade the quality of files already downloaded when a better quality format becomes available.

Configure Radarr - Newsgroups

Follow the steps in order to ensure the successful configuration of Radarr!

Turning on Advanced Settings

  • Click Settings in the Upper Right Corner
  • Change [ Advanced Settings ] to Shown and Click Save

Media Management Tab

  • Rename Movies: Yes
  • Analyze Video Files: No
  • Click [Save] in the Upper Right Corner

Profiles Tab & Quality Tabs

  • Recommend to keep the [Any] Profile
  • Make your adjusts for the [Any] Profile

Adjust Quality

  • Not adjusting the max may result in downloading 15GB files
  • Not adjusting the minimum size may result in 300MB 1080P files

Indexers Tab

  • Require At Least 1 Indexer
  • Optional To disable download of 3D movie files.
  • Restrictions: Must not contain, 3D, 3d,SBS,sbs.

Download Client Tab

  • Select SABNZBD and turn this one on
  • Name: SABNZBD
  • Host: Domain or IPv4 Address (do not use localhost)
  • Port: 8090
  • API Key: Visit SABNZBD @ http://your-address:8090/sabnzbd/config/general/ and retrieve the API key
  • Username: If you created one in SABNZBD, put it here; otherwise leave blank
  • Password: If you created one in SABNZBD, put it here; otherwise leave blank
  • Category: Movies
  • Recent Priority: High
  • Older Priority: Normal or Low

Configure Radarr - Torrents

  • Make sure under Settings -> Media Management you have "Analyze" video files" turned OFF

  • Also enable renaming of episodes.

  • Indexer

  • For torrents from providers like IPT you will need to use Jackett(refer to Jackett setup)

  • Select Torznab.

  • Paste in your URL you got from Jackett(click Copy Torznab Feed on the Indexer from Jackett you want)

  • Paste in your API Key (copy the API key from Jackett at the top left)

  • Click Save

  • On the "Download Client" tab we will add rutorrent or deluge. RUTORRENT:

  • Click the add symbol and add click rtorrent.

  • Give it a name

  • For host give it an ip address or domain name.(you can try localhost here but sometimes that doesn't work.)

  • Port: 8999 (write down your port when doing the rtorrent container install it might be different to mine.)

  • URL Path leave it as is.

  • Then click test. If successful congrats! If it is not then try a different Host and make sure your port is correct.
